What are the signs of a dirty chimney?

Visible signs of a dirty chimney include a noticeable layer of black soot or flaky creosote on the interior of the flue, a distinct smoky odor emanating from the fireplace when not in use, or visible soot falling from the damper. In Nevada's arid climate, dust and debris can also contribute to blockages, making regular inspections in Las Vegas essential.

What does a chimney sweep do?

A professional chimney sweep, such as those at AverageChimneySweep Services, performs a comprehensive inspection and cleaning of your chimney system. This involves removing flammable creosote deposits, soot, and any obstructions from the flue and firebox, ensuring safe and efficient operation of your appliance and adherence to safety standards prevalent in Nevada.
